2) Congratulations to the Shrewsbury High School Speech & Debate team, who earned second place in the state championships!  This is a remarkable achievement for the team, Head Coach Marc Rischitelli, and the assistant coaches given that due to the pandemic the team members had to shift from in-person competition to performing virtually over videoconference, which is an excellent example of adapting to challenging circumstances and persevering.  Congratulations as well to three SHS students who won individual state championships: Sophia Peng (Informative Speaking); Haleema Siddiqui (Poetry Reading); and Pranav Vadlamudi (Play Reading).
